You're correct, of course. I missed the "right" part of the question.
How about this then:
EVAL NewVariable =
%SUBST(%TRIM(MYVAR):%LEN(%TRIM(MYVAR)) - 9:10)
As long as you always have at least ten non-blank characters, this should
work.
I haven't tested it, though...
